[4-(1-Pyrrolidin-1-ylethyl)phenyl]boronic acid is widely utilized in research focused on:
- Organic Synthesis: This compound serves as a versatile building block in the synthesis of various organic molecules, enabling chemists to create complex structures efficiently.
- Medicinal Chemistry: It plays a crucial role in drug development, particularly in the design of pharmaceuticals targeting specific biological pathways, enhancing therapeutic efficacy.
- Material Science: The compound is used in the development of advanced materials, such as polymers and nanomaterials, which have applications in electronics and coatings.
- Catalysis: It acts as a catalyst in various chemical reactions, improving reaction rates and selectivity, which is vital for industrial processes and research applications.
- Bioconjugation: This boronic acid derivative is employed in bioconjugation techniques, facilitating the attachment of biomolecules to surfaces or other molecules, which is essential in diagnostics and therapeutic applications.
